Basement Drainage Installation in Framingham, MA
Basement drainage installation services focus on creating effective systems to manage excess water around a property’s foundation, helping to prevent flooding, water damage, and mold growth. These projects typically involve installing or upgrading drainage solutions such as interior or exterior sump pumps, drainage pipes, and waterproof barriers to ensure proper water flow away from the basement area. Homeowners often request this service when experiencing persistent dampness, water seepage during heavy rains, or planning renovations that require improved moisture control to protect the integrity of the basement space.
Before requesting basement drainage installation, property owners should consider the existing condition of their foundation and drainage setup, as well as any history of water intrusion. It’s useful to understand the scope of work needed-whether it involves repairing existing drainage systems or installing entirely new ones-and to be aware of any specific features of the property that may influence the project, such as landscaping or underground utilities.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the installation effectively addresses water management concerns and supports the long-term dryness and stability of the basement.

Common Basement Drainage Installation Jobs
Basement Drainage Systems - installed to direct water away from the foundation and prevent flooding.
French Drains - designed to improve underground water flow and reduce basement moisture.
Sump Pump Installations - help remove excess water and keep basements dry during heavy rains.
Drain Tile Systems - installed around the foundation to collect and redirect groundwater.
Waterproofing Drains - integrated with foundation sealing to prevent water seepage into basements.
Drain Maintenance - services to ensure existing drainage systems function effectively over time.
Basement Drainage Installation Questions
What is basement drainage installation? It involves setting up systems to direct water away from the basement to prevent flooding and water damage.
Why is proper drainage important for basements? Effective drainage reduces the risk of basement flooding, mold growth, and structural issues caused by excess moisture.
What types of drainage systems are commonly installed? Common options include interior drain tiles, exterior waterproofing, and sump pump systems to manage water flow.
How can I tell if my basement needs drainage improvements? Signs include damp walls, water stains, musty odors, or frequent flooding during heavy rains.
